The field of farm safety and health offers promising career prospects for individuals passionate about promoting safety in agriculture. With the increasing focus on farm safety regulations and standards, professionals in this field are in high demand.
Professionals in farm safety and health can progress into roles such as farm safety manager, agricultural safety consultant, or health and safety officer in agricultural organizations. Continuous learning and certifications in occupational health and safety can further enhance career opportunities.
Responsible for overseeing safety programs, conducting risk assessments, and developing safety policies on farms.
Provides expert advice on farm safety practices, conducts safety audits, and offers training to farm workers.
